1 In the twenty-seventh year of Jeroboam, the king of Israel: Azariah, the son of Amaziah, reigned as king of Judah.
Bere a Yeroboam a ɔto so abien di ade wɔ Israel no, ne mfe aduonu ason so na Amasia babarima Asaria fii ase dii ade wɔ Yuda.
2 He was sixteen years old when he had begun to reign, and he reigned for fifty-two years in Jerusalem. The name of his mother was Jecoliah of Jerusalem.
Obedii hene no, na wadi mfe dunsia. Na odii ade wɔ Yerusalem mfirihyia aduonum abien. Na ne na din de Yekolia a ofi Yerusalem.
3 And he did what was pleasing before the Lord, in accord with all that his father, Amaziah, did.
Na ɔteɛ wɔ Awurade ani so, sɛnea nʼagya Amasia teɛ no.
4 Yet truly, he did not demolish the high places. And still the people were sacrificing, and burning incense, in the high places.
Wansɛe abosonnan a na nnipa kɔbɔ afɔre, kɔhyew nnuhuam wɔ hɔ no.
5 Now the Lord struck the king, and he became a leper, even until the day of his death. And he was living in a separate house by himself. And truly, Jotham, the son of the king, governed the palace, and he judged the people of the land.
Awurade maa kwata yɛɛ ɔhene no, kosii da a owui. Ne saa nti, na ɔno nko te ofi bi mu. Yotam a na ɔyɛ ɔhene no babarima na ɔhwɛɛ ahemfi no so, na odii nnipa a wɔwɔ asase no so no so.
6 Now the rest of the words of Azariah, and all that he did, have these not been written in the book of the words of the days of the kings of Judah?
Na Asaria adedi ho nsɛm nkae ne dwuma a odii nyinaa no, wɔankyerɛw angu Yuda Ahemfo Abakɔsɛm Nhoma no mu ana?
7 And Azariah slept with his fathers, and they buried him with his ancestors in the city of David. And Jotham, his son, reigned in his place.
Asaria wui no, wosiee no wɔ ne mpanyimfo nkyɛn wɔ Dawid kurow mu. Na ne babarima Yotam na odii nʼade sɛ ɔhene.
8 In the thirty-eighth year of Azariah, the king of Judah: Zechariah, the son of Jeroboam, reigned over Israel, in Samaria, for six months.
Yudahene Asaria dii ade no, ne mfe aduasa awotwe mu no na Yeroboam a ɔto so abien babarima Sakaria nso dii ade Israel wɔ Samaria. Odii ade asram asia.
9 And he did what is evil before the Lord, just as his fathers had done. He did not withdraw from the sins of Jeroboam, the son of Nebat, who caused Israel to sin.
Ɔyɛɛ bɔne wɔ Awurade ani so, sɛnea nʼagyanom yɛe no. Wamfi ahonisom a Nebat babarima Yeroboam maa Israelfo som no ho.
10 Then Shallum, the son of Jabesh, conspired against him. And he struck him openly, and killed him. And he reigned in his place.
Na Yabes babarima Salum bɔɔ pɔw de tiaa Sakaria, kum no wɔ bagua mu, dii akongua no.
11 Now the rest of the words of Zechariah, have these not been written in the book of the words of the days of the kings of Israel?
Sakaria dwuma a odii nkae no, wɔankyerɛw angu Israel Ahemfo Abakɔsɛm Nhoma no mu ana?
12 This was the word of the Lord, which he spoke to Jehu, saying: “Your sons, even to the fourth generation, shall sit upon the throne of Israel.” And so it happened.
Enti, Awurade asɛm a ɔka kyerɛɛ, Yehu se, “Wʼasefo na wɔbɛyɛ Israel ahemfo akosi awo ntoatoaso a ɛto so anan” mu no, baa mu.
13 Shallum, the son of Jabesh, reigned in the thirty-ninth year of Azariah, the king of Judah. And he reigned for one month, in Samaria.
Yabes babarima Salum bedii Israel so hene no, na ɛyɛ Yudahene Usia adedi mfe aduasa akron mu. Salum dii ade wɔ Samaria ɔsram baako pɛ.
14 And Menahem, the son of Gadi, ascended from Tirzah. And he went into Samaria, and he struck Shallum, the son of Jabesh, in Samaria. And he killed him, and reigned in his place.
Afei, Gadi babarima Menahem fii Tirsa kɔɔ Samaria. Ɔkɔtow hyɛɛ Yabes babarima Salum so kum no, na ɔtenaa akongua no so.
15 Now the rest of the words of Shallum, and his conspiracy, by which he carried out treachery, have these not been written in the book of the words of the days of the kings of Israel?
Salum ahenni ho nsɛm nkae ne pɔw a ɔbɔe no, wɔankyerɛw angu Israel Ahemfo Abakɔsɛm Nhoma no mu?
16 Then Menahem struck Tirzah, and all who were in it, and its borders around Tirzah. For they were not willing to open to him. And he killed all of its pregnant women, and he tore them open.
Saa bere no mu, Menahem fii Tirsa kɔtoaa Tifsa ne obiara a ɔwɔ hɔ ne ne nkurow nyinaa, efisɛ ɛhɔfo no ampene so sɛ wɔde kurow no bɛma. Okunkum kurow no mu nnipa nyinaa, paapae emu apemfo nyinaa yafunu mu.
17 In the thirty-ninth year of Azariah, the king of Judah: Menahem, son of Gadi, reigned over Israel for ten years, in Samaria.
Gadi babarima Menahem fii ase dii Israelhene bere a na Usia adi ade wɔ Yuda ne mfe aduasa akron so. Odii hene wɔ Samaria mfirihyia du.
18 And he did what was evil before the Lord. He did not withdraw from the sins of Jeroboam, the son of Nebat, who caused Israel to sin, during all his days.
Nanso Menahem yɛɛ bɔne wɔ Awurade ani so. Nʼahenni mu nyinaa, wannyae bɔne a ɛyɛ ahonisom no a na Nebat babarima Yeroboam adi Israelfo anim de wɔn asom no.
19 Then Pul, the king of the Assyrians, came into the land. And Menahem gave Pul one thousand talents of silver, so that he would be a help to him, and so that he might strengthen his kingdom.
Afei, Asiriahene Pul bedii asase no so. Na Menahem tuaa dwetɛ nkaribo tɔn aduasa ason maa no sɛnea ɔbɛtaa nʼakyi ama nʼahenni no atim.
20 And Menahem proclaimed a tax upon Israel, on all who were powerful and wealthy, so that each one would give to the king of the Assyrians fifty shekels of silver. Then the king of the Assyrians turned back, and he did not remain in the land.
Menahem nam apoobɔ so gyigyee Israel asikafo no mu biara nkyɛn dwetɛ a ɛkari gram ahannum aduoson de maa Asiriahene. Ɛno nti, Asiriahene ankɔtow anhyɛ Israel so, na wantena asase no so nso.
21 Now the rest of the words of Menahem, and all that he did, have these not been written in the book of the words of the days of the kings of Israel?
Na Menahem adedi ho nsɛm nkae ne dwuma a odii nyinaa, wɔankyerɛw angu Israel Ahemfo Abakɔsɛm Nhoma no mu ana?
22 And Menahem slept with his fathers. And Pekahiah, his son, reigned in his place.
Bere a Menahem wui no, ne babarima Pekahia na odii nʼade sɛ ɔhene.
23 In the fiftieth year of Azariah, the king of Judah: Pekahiah, the son of Menahem, reigned over Israel, in Samaria, for two years.
Menahem babarima Pekahia fii ase dii Israelhene wɔ Yudahene Usia ahenni ne mfe aduonum so. Odii hene wɔ Samaria mfe abien.
24 And he did what was evil before the Lord. He did not withdraw from the sins of Jeroboam, the son of Nebat, who caused Israel to sin.
Nanso Pekahia yɛɛ bɔne wɔ Awurade ani so. Wantwe ne ho amfi ahonisom a Nebat babarima Yeroboam dii Israelfo anim ma wɔsom no ho.
25 Then Pekah, the son of Remaliah, his commander, conspired against him. And he struck him in Samaria, in the tower of the king’s house, near Argob and Arieh, and with him fifty men from the sons of the Gileadites. And he killed him, and reigned in his place.
Na Remalia babarima Peka a na ɔyɛ Pekahia asraafo so sahene no bɔɔ pɔw tiaa no. Ɔfaa mmarima aduonum fii Gilead, kaa ne ho, kokum ɔhene no ne Argob ne Arie wɔ Samaria ahemfi abangua mu. Peka na afei obedii hene wɔ Israel.
26 Now the rest of the words of Pekahiah, and all that he did, have these not been written in the book of the words of the days of the kings of Israel?
Pekahia ahenni ho nsɛm nkae ne dwuma a odii nyinaa, wɔankyerɛw angu Israel Ahemfo Abakɔsɛm Nhoma no mu ana?
27 In the fifty-second year of Azariah, the king of Judah: Pekah, the son of Remaliah, reigned over Israel, in Samaria, for twenty years.
Remalia babarima Peka bedii hene wɔ Israel wɔ bere a na Usia adi hene wɔ Yuda mfe aduonum abien. Odii ade wɔ Samaria mfirihyia aduonu.
28 And he did what was evil before the Lord. He did not withdraw from the sins of Jeroboam, the son of Nebat, who caused Israel to sin.
Nanso Peka yɛɛ bɔne wɔ Awurade ani so. Wantwe ne ho amfi ahonisom a Nebat babarima Yeroboam dii Israel anim ma wɔsom no ho.
29 In the days of Pekah, the king of Israel, Tiglath-pileser, the king of Assyria, arrived and captured Ijon, and Abel Bethmaacah, and Janoah, and Kedesh, and Hazor, and Gilead, and Galilee, and the entire land of Naphtali. And he took them away into Assyria.
Peka ahenni so no, Asiriahene Tiglat-Pileser kɔtoaa Israelfo bio, faa nkurow Iyon ne Abel-Bet-Maaka ne Yanoa ne Kedes ne Hasor ne Gilead ne Galilea ne Naftali nsase nyinaa. Na ɔfaa nnipa no nnommum kɔɔ Asiria.
30 Then Hoshea, the son of Elah, conspired and carried out treachery against Pekah, the son of Remaliah. And he struck him, and killed him. And he reigned in his place, in the twentieth year of Jotham, the son of Uzziah.
Na Ela babarima Hosea bɔɔ pɔw, tiaa Peka na okum no. Ofii ase dii Israel so hene bere a na Usia babarima Yotam nso adi ade mfe aduonu wɔ Yuda.
31 Now the rest of the words of Pekah, and all that he did, have these not been written in the book of the words of the days of the kings of Israel?
Peka adedi mu nsɛm nkae ne dwuma a odii nyinaa, wɔankyerɛw angu Israel Ahemfo Abakɔsɛm Nhoma no mu ana?
32 In the second year of Pekah, the son of Remaliah, the king of Israel: Jotham, son of Uzziah, reigned as king of Judah.
Usia babarima Yotam dii hene wɔ Yuda bere a na ɔhene Peka adi ade wɔ Israel mfirihyia abien.
33 He was twenty-five years old when he had begun to reign, and he reigned for sixteen years in Jerusalem. The name of his mother was Jerusha, the daughter of Zadok.
Odii ade no, na wadi mfirihyia aduonu anum, na odii Yerusalem so hene mfe dunsia. Na ne na a ɔyɛ Sadok babea no din de Yerusa.
34 And he did what was pleasing before the Lord. In accord with all that his father, Uzziah, had done, so he did.
Yotam yɛɛ nea ɛsɔ Awurade ani, sɛnea nʼagya Usia yɛe no ara pɛ.
35 Yet truly, he did not take away the high places. And still the people were immolating, and burning incense, in the high places. But he edified the gate of the house of the Lord to be very sublime.
Nanso wansɛe abosonnan a na nnipa kɔbɔ afɔre, kɔhyew nnuhuam wɔ hɔ no. Ɔno ne obi a ɔsan sii Awurade Asɔredan no atifi pon.
36 Now the rest of the words of Jotham, and all that he did, have these not been written in the book of the words of the days of the kings of Judah?
Yotam ahenni ho nsɛm nkae ne nea ɔyɛe nyinaa, wɔankyerɛw angu Yuda Ahemfo Abakɔsɛm Nhoma no mu ana?
37 In those days, the Lord began to send, into Judah, Rezin, the king of Syria, and Pekah, the son of Remaliah.
Saa mmere no mu, Awurade fii ase somaa Aramhene Resin ne Israelhene Peka, sɛ wɔnkɔtow nhyɛ Yuda so.
38 And Jotham slept with his fathers, and he was buried with them in the city of David, his father. And Ahaz, his son, reigned in his place.
Bere a Yotam wui no, wosiee no wɔ ne mpanyimfo nkyɛn wɔ Dawid kurow mu. Na ne babarima Ahas bedii nʼade sɛ ɔhene.
